WebN-palmitoylation (amide bonds), respectively (Hannoush, 2015; Thinon and Hang, 2015)(Figure 1). On the other hand, N-myris-toylation involves the addition of a 14-carbon fatty acid via an amide bond to the a-amino group of an N-terminal glycine residue. In this review, S-palmitoylation and S-acylation are interchangeable terms. WebNov 27, 2024 · Furthermore, mutation of palmitoylation sites impaired protein trafficking to the plasma membrane, and intra-Golgi transport was specifically affected. anterograde … WebProtein S-palmitoylation is a reversible post-translational lipidation in which palmitic acid (16:0) is added to protein cysteine residue by a covalent thioester bond. This modification plays an active role in membrane targeting of soluble proteins, protein–protein interaction, protein trafficking, and subcellular localization.
